Transaction 977688ba5999eafe36c451a6d3bdcbc6468e1860909f7b5512bffbe384a9673c

35 Input
2 Outputs
  • 977688ba5999eafe36c451a6d3bdcbc6468e1860909f7b5512bffbe384a9673c:0
  • value  487027333
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 977688ba5999eafe36c451a6d3bdcbc6468e1860909f7b5512bffbe384a9673c:1
  • value  565598
    address  3NCyvQdRN9YZFhdxcPg8yJPcU3STqpoNjn